About the role

The Family Living Director (FLD) oversees one of our community-based residential homes, providing care and support to three (maximum of six) adults with developmental disabilities. Hours may vary between weekdays and weekends, and may be a live-in or live-out position. Scheduling is based on the needs of the home and residents.

Responsibilities

  • Directly supervises all Direct Support Professionals assigned to their home.
  • Interviews, hires, trains, and appraises employees.
  • Plans, assigns, directs, and resolves work issues.
  • Reviews and approves timesheets.
  • Manages house schedule, budget, and overtime.
  • Ensures a safe environment and reports maintenance needs.
  • Supports residents in developing friendships and community involvement.
  • Provides individualized attention and maintains a comfortable, organized home.
  • Communicates with relevant parties and documents information.
  • Attends mandatory meetings and conducts house meetings.
  • Reports incidents of abuse or neglect and follows safety practices.

Requirements

  • At least 21 years old.
  • A nurturing and caring demeanor.
  • A genuine interest in supporting the independence of those we serve.
  • A high school diploma or GED equivalent.
  • A college degree preferred.
  • A minimum of 2 years of experience in the human services field.
  • A minimum of 1 year of supervisory experience.
  • A valid Maryland driver's license with no more than three points.
